SaltStick Electrolyte Capsules deliver a precise blend of six essential electrolytes plus Vitamin D3 to maintain optimal hydration and muscle function during endurance activities. With a clean, non-GMO, gluten-free formula, these capsules are designed for easy, on-the-go use by runners, cyclists, and athletes seeking to prevent cramps and boost performance without the hassle of mixing powders or tablets.

Works a treat, I've used these twice at Ironman ...
Works a treat, I've used these twice at Ironman events, I have a tendency to have leg cramps especially when really going for it, these prevented the cramps both times. Much more practical than the fizzy electrolyte tabs at water bottles are handed to you on the move so no opportunity to put fizzy ones in without stopping. With the Saltsticks I just pop 2 in my mouth every hour and wash down with water or coke or whatever is in my bottle. Highly recommended

WARNING - Ingredients vary depending who you buy it from!!
The product is excellent. I use it to prevent migraines as well as general hydration. BUT - if you order from a foreign supplier it does not contain Vitamin D. The first bottle I ordered came from a UK supplier and was as described, with an English label. The second bottle I ordered came from an English sounding supplier and only after it arrived did I delve deeper to see the supplier was French. This bottle does not contain the vitamin D and the label is in French. So now I only purchase from the English company.

Cramp Killer
One of the best ways to avoid cramp while on a bike ride or run. Cycling is my preference and I tend to start feeling the cramp ache in my lower quad (typically rectus femoris & vastus medialis - yes, I had to look up those names! In laymans terms the middle thigh muscle that leads to your knee cap and as you are looking down at your knee that lump of muscle that sits above your knee and to the left) around the 50 mile mark of an event based ride during the summer months. It's a combination of fatigue from pushing a little harder on event day, age (nearly 49), and dehydration which sucks the salts away. Before you roll your eyes at dehydration, yes I do take on fluid in the form of High 5 4:1 High 5 4:1 Summer Fruits Energy Source 1.6Kg , as well as gels and food, it's just the combination of factors that tips me into cramp-ville. With the extra help of Saltstick I can prevent the cramp and enjoy my ride

If you suffer from cramps on long rides like I do because I sweat a lot
If you suffer from cramps on long rides like I do because I sweat a lot, these are awesome!!! Knew after trying them they kept cramps at bay, but when I cramped on a long ride when I was pushing hard and forgot to take them as I was trying to catch another group. Took these and 15 mins later I was good to go, completely got rid of the cramps. Only works for what I asume electrolyte related cramps as I have a high sweat rate. Don't think will work if your suffer cramps through muscle fatigue as your maybe not fit enough.
